Will Ward is a Licensed Clinical Social Worker with over 10 years of experience working with children, adolescents, and their families in school-based, congregational, and community settings. He continues to work as a therapist in his community specializing in children and adolescents. He is also an adjunct instructor at the Garland School of Social Work at Baylor, teaching generalist and advanced practicum courses and courses in the clinical specialization. Will studies how religion and spirituality have both harmed and been a source of support for LGBTQ folks. He holds a bachelor’s degree from Williams Baptist College, an M.Div. from Truett Seminary at Baylor University, and a Master of Social Work from the Diana R. Garland School of Social Work at Baylor, and plans to complete his Ph.D. in Social Work at Baylor in December 2024.
